The phrase primarily refers to the industry-standard sheet music collection published by Schott Music , titled Test Pieces for Orchestral Auditions . This series is used worldwide by conservatories and professional orchestras to define standard audition repertoire. 1. Standard Audition Repertoire (The Guide)
